A scientist who studies human bones is called an osteologist. Osteologists examine the structure, function, and health of bones, often in the context of anthropology, archaeology, or medicine. Their work can provide insights into human evolution, health, and the effects of various conditions on the skeletal system.
An entomologist is a scientist who studies insects. They research various aspects of insects including their biology, behavior, ecology, and taxonomy. Entomologists play a crucial role in understanding the impact insects have on ecosystems and human activities.
Someone who studies humans is called an anthropologist. Anthropologists explore various aspects of human societies, cultures, and biological characteristics, often focusing on social behavior, cultural practices, and human evolution. Their work can encompass fields like archaeology, cultural anthropology, and physical anthropology.

An anthropologist studies the physical characteristics, behaviors, and cultures of humans and their ancestors. They examine aspects such as language, customs, social structures, and evolutionary history to understand human diversity and development over time.
